Firstly, back up your database and website files to a safe place (like a hard drive or on your desktop, that should be fine). Then you can switch your php version to whatever you like. Obviously select a newer version.
Most web hosts will pre-select all of the libraries you need for each php version so it should be okay and everything should work without issue. However, check over everything and make sure it’s all in working order.
You may have extensions running that don’t work with newer versions. As far as I know phpBB is rated for 7.1 to 7.4 but 8.0 does introduce a lot of changes so be mindful when updating to it.
